Dental care is as important for children of all ages as it is for adults. However, it can help to find a children’s dentist rather than taking your child to a dental practice that primarily services adults. Children’s dental offices are designed with younger patients in mind, striving to create a fun, relaxing environment without compromising oral healthcare.
Tips for finding the right children’s dentist
It can be difficult to choose between all the qualified dentists out there. Therefore, a good first step is gathering a list of children’s dentists, then narrowing down this list. Below are a few tips to consider when seeking a dentist for your family:
1. Check online and by word of mouth
First, knowing where to look for a children’s dentist is important. Looking online at various healthcare directories is a great start. Parents can also call their insurance providers and ask for a recommendation. Consider asking family, friends, and coworkers with children, as well. Exploring these avenues can help parents build an extensive list of potential dentists.
2. Take your child’s dental needs into account
Once parents have their list compiled, they should consider their child’s dental needs when narrowing it down. For instance, if the child fears the dentist or has anxiety about a checkup, talk to the dentist to see what techniques they have to help the child feel more comfortable. It is also crucial to consider whether the child needs early orthodontic treatment or only general services, such as teeth cleanings and oral exams. If the child needs both, parents may look for a dentist who can provide both to avoid searching for an orthodontist in a few months. Alternatively, if the child is past the age for early orthodontic treatment, there is no need to find a dentist who offers this service.
3. Read online reviews
To reduce the chances of a bad dental experience, read online reviews of each dentist remaining on the list. Sometimes, a children’s dentist may have good reviews for certain services (such as dental cleanings) but poor reviews in other areas (like early orthodontic treatment). Client reviews and testimonials may be found on the dentist’s website, next to their listings in dental health directories, or even on Google or Yelp.
4. Look at the dentist’s location and hours
Finally, consider where the children’s dental office is located and their hours of operation. If the dentist is too far away or only open on the days of the week when the parent is unavailable, it does not matter how good the dentist is. Finding a dental office nearby or somewhere along the route from the child’s school to home can be a major bonus. For instance, it allows the child and dentist more time for treatments. The convenience also reduces stress for parents and children. This can ultimately lead to a more positive experience for all parties.
